What are Bing Quizzes?
When you search for "Bing Quizzes," you might expect to find a single quiz with that exact name. However, "Bing Quizzes" is actually the collective term for Microsoft's collection of interactive trivia challenges. There isn't one quiz called "Bing Quizzes." Instead, Microsoft offers several different quiz types, each with its own format and topics.
This collection includes the Bing Quiz for general knowledge, the Homepage Quiz tied to Bing's daily images, the News Quiz covering current headlines, the Entertainment Quiz focused on pop culture, and the Extraordinary Women Quiz celebrating influential female figures throughout history.
The beauty of Bing Quizzes lies in its integration with Microsoft Rewards. Every quiz you complete earns points that convert into real rewards: Amazon gift cards, Xbox Game Pass, Microsoft Store credit, and charitable donations. You can replay quizzes unlimited times daily to maximize your points.

Microsoft Rewards Points System
One of the biggest advantages of playing Bing Quizzes is earning Microsoft Rewards points—a loyalty program that converts your quiz participation into real-world value. Understanding how the points system works helps you maximize earnings and redeem for meaningful rewards.
Points Earning Breakdown
Microsoft Rewards offers multiple ways to earn points daily, with quizzes being one key component.
Daily Earning Activities
| Activity | Points | Frequency |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bing Quizzes | Varies | Daily/Weekly | Each quiz awards points |
| Daily Set Activities | 30-50 | Daily | Quiz + Poll + Task |
| PC Search | Up to 90 | Daily | 3 pts per search |
| Mobile Search | Varies | Daily, Separate limit | |
| Microsoft Edge Bonus | Additional | Daily | Use of the Edge browser |
Microsoft Rewards Levels
Microsoft Rewards has three membership levels with different benefits.
Member (Starting Level)
- PC Search: Up to 15 searches daily (45 points max)
- Monthly Bonuses: Default search (30), level bonus (60), STAR bonus (up to 300)
Silver Member
Requirements: Earn 500+ points in a month
- PC Search: Up to 30 searches daily (90 points max)
- Monthly Bonuses: Default search (90), level bonus (180), STAR bonus (up to 900)
- Perks: Exclusive offers, 100-point redemption discount
Gold Member
Requirements: Earn 750+ points in a month AND complete 2 level up activities
- PC Search: Up to 60 searches daily (180 points max)
- Monthly Bonuses: Default search (210), level bonus (420), STAR bonus (up to 2,100)
- Perks: Exclusive offers, 200-point redemption discount
Level Up Activities (Complete 2 for Gold)
- Use Bing as the default search engine for 14 days
- Search with Bing for 7 consecutive days
- Get Xbox Game Pass Ultimate

How Points Credit
Points automatically add to your balance when signed into your Microsoft account. Monthly bonuses appear within the first 5 days of each month and must be manually claimed from your dashboard.

Points Expiration
Points expire after 18 months of account inactivity. Any earning or redemption activity resets the clock. Regular quiz players never face expiration.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Even with Bing Quizzes' straightforward design, you may occasionally encounter technical problems or questions about functionality. This section addresses the most common issues and provides solutions to get you back to earning points quickly.
Quiz Not Appearing
Problem: You visit Bing.com but don't see the graduation cap icon or quiz interface.
Solutions:
- Check JavaScript: Ensure JavaScript is enabled in your browser settings. Bing Quizzes requires JavaScript to function.
- Refresh the Page: Sometimes the quiz icon takes a few seconds to load. Press F5 (or Cmd+R on Mac) to refresh. Clear your browser cache if refreshing doesn't work.
- Disable Ad Blockers: Some ad-blocking extensions interfere with interactive Bing elements. Whitelist Bing.com in your ad blocker settings or temporarily disable the extension.
- Try a Different Browser: If one browser fails, test Chrome, Edge, Firefox, or Safari to isolate whether it's browser-specific.
- Check Your Region: Some quiz types have limited regional availability. Verify your country supports the specific quiz you're seeking.
- Time Zone Differences: Homepage Quiz refreshes at midnight local time. If it's 11:59 PM, wait one minute for the new quiz to appear.
Points Not Crediting
Problem: You completed a quiz but didn't receive the expected points.
Solutions:
- Verify Sign-In: Points only credit when you're signed into your Microsoft account BEFORE starting the quiz. If you completed a quiz while signed out, those points are lost. Always sign in first.
- Wait 24 Hours: Points typically credit instantly, but occasionally take up to 24 hours during high-traffic periods or system maintenance. Check your balance tomorrow before assuming there's an issue.
- Check Daily Limits: Microsoft Rewards has daily earning limits for searches (150 desktop, 100 mobile at Level 2). If you've hit these limits, additional activity won't earn points. Quiz points generally don't have limits.
- Review Activity History: Visit rewards.microsoft.com → Activity history to see detailed point transactions. This shows whether the quiz completion was registered.
- Browser Cookies: Ensure cookies are enabled for Bing.com and microsoft.com. Disabled cookies prevent proper activity tracking.
- Contact Support: If points still don't appear after 24 hours and you were definitely signed in, contact Microsoft Rewards support through the dashboard Help section.
